Ticket: Formula sandbox escape via nested eval — Quillframe platform. User-supplied formulas passed to the Quillframe expression engine could reach host functions through chained helper calls. Plugin authors: formulas now run in a restricted interpreter with an allowlist of pure functions; anything touching I/O or reflection is rejected at parse time. Update your plugins to declare required functions in the manifest. The fix ships in the build referenced below.

trace token, fafog-kageg: htk4_98e6

## Changelog — ExportRelay 3.2.0

Changed defaults for failed-export retries. Previous behavior: three attempts, fixed 30s delay, then drop. New behavior: exponential backoff with jitter, capped attempts, and dead-letter routing to the Holdfast queue. On-call impact: fewer repeating pager alerts, but dead-letter depth now needs watching. Alerts for the old retry counter were removed; the new ones fire on dead-letter growth. Rollback requires a config revert, not a redeploy. Effective defaults follow.

deployment values, kajep-kageg:
[praix]
host = praix.paliqcorp.corp
user = praix_svc
database = praix_prod

# Service Accounts — Docslint

Quick note for the sync: Docslint (our docs linter bot) now runs under its own service account instead of borrowing the CI one. It only needs read access to the Quillcheck API to fetch style rules, so scope is minimal. If the bot stalls, reauth it with the key below.

API key for yahig-tadup: kto7_ubizbYm

## Runbook: GraphQL N+1 Fix (Thornquist API)

So, the short version: the Thornquist gateway used to fire one query per list item, which flattened the database every Monday morning. We added a batching dataloader, and it's been calm since. If latency graphs spike again, check that batching didn't get disabled in a hotfix — it's happened twice. Cache TTLs are deliberately short; don't crank them up without asking. The dataloader reads the following configuration values when the gateway boots.

settings of yahag-yafog:
[pramir]
host = pramir.qirvancorp.internal
user = pramir_svc
database = pramir_prod